Good news for borrowers! Recent reports confirm that loan interest rates have decreased, with offers now as low as 1.9% for high loan-to-value (LTV) loans. For many, this reduction comes at a timely moment as people look to capitalize on recent dips in Bitcoin prices.

Rate Changes Spark Conversations

Customers noticed these lower rates after logging into their Credit Hub accounts. The standard rate now stands at 9.9%. Borrowing conditions are looking promising, and many are contemplating taking advantage of these changes.
